constellr is a Freiburg company founded in 2019 that builds satellites measuring land surface temperature. Its thermal imagery helps agriculture and water management detect crop stress before it is visible. The company spun out of Fraunhofer research and is deploying its own small satellite constellation.

Your Role

You will join the constellr Mission & Space Segment team, playing a key role in shaping the onboard software that powers our satellite constellation across its full lifecycle - from early design through to in-orbit operations. 

This is a hands-on, high-impact role where you will help define how our satellites compute, behave, and evolve in space. Your work will directly influence the reliability, performance, and long-term success of constellr’s mission. 

You’ll collaborate closely across the business - working day-to-day with internal engineering teams, Product Assurance, Project Management, and Operations, as well as external suppliers. Together, you will help turn mission concepts into robust, flight-ready software systems. 

In addition to software development, you will contribute to system-level design decisions, support procurement and supplier technical alignment, and help ensure our onboard software is continuously validated, improved, and ready for operation in orbit. 

Key responsibilities

  • Design, develop, test, and maintain high-reliability onboard flight software in compliance with product assurance and safety standards.

  • Collaborate with cross-functional stakeholders to define, refine, and manage software requirements across all onboard satellite systems.

  • Contribute to the definition and evolution of onboard software architecture, supporting both laboratory-based validation environments and in-orbit operational systems.

  • Develop and implement robust Fault Detection, Isolation and Recovery (FDIR) strategies to ensure resilience and autonomy of onboard systems.

  • Support the planning, coordination, and delivery of new software features and upgrades, working closely with external suppliers and development partners.

  • Champion strong configuration management practices across all onboard software components to ensure traceability, integrity, and control.

  • Define and drive verification and validation strategies, ensuring comprehensive testing and high confidence in flight software performance.

  • Participate in end-to-end verification and validation activities for onboard systems and flight software.

  • Ensure all software-whether developed in-house or delivered by suppliers-meets stringent technical, safety, and quality requirements.

  • Support investigation and resolution of software anomalies and non-conformance issues, contributing to continuous improvement and system reliability.

  • Help define and enhance the in-orbit software update process for satellites within the constellation fleet.

  • Contribute to integration and testing activities using Flatsat environments and other ground-based simulation and validation platforms.
